Abstract

The purpose of this study was to determine the correlation of leg muscle strength with smash accuracy, to determine the correlation of hand eye coordination with smash accuracy, to determine the correlation of arm muscle strength with smash accuracy and to determine the correlation of leg muscle strength, hand eye coordination and arm muscle strength with smash accuracy in volleyball game at the Mars 76 Volleyball Club Kediri City in 2023. In this study the approach used was a quantitative approach, researchers used a correlational method. The population and sample in this study were 15 women's volleyball athletes from Mars 76. Data collection techniques in research are test and measurement techniques. Based on the results of the study, it showed that there was a significant relationship between leg muscle strength and smash accuracy, with rx1.y = 3.502 > r(0.05)(15) = 0.382, there was a significant relationship between hand eye coordination and smash accuracy, with rx2.y = 3.433 > r(0.05)(15) = 0.472 and there is a significant relationship between arm muscle strength and smash accuracy, with rx3.y = 1.851 > r(0.05)(15) = 0.462. From the results of this analysis, the correlation coefficient between leg muscle strength, eye-hand coordination and arm muscle strength was obtained with a smash accuracy of 0.515. The weight test for the correlation coefficient was carried out by consulting the value of F count 4,850 > F table at a significance level of 5% and degrees of freedom 3;15, namely 3,187, and Rx1.x2.x3.y = 0.515 > R(0.05)(15) = 3,187 , means that the correlation coefficient is significant. The hypothesis reads "There is a significant relationship between leg muscle strength, eye-hand coordination and arm muscle strength with smash accuracy.
